Output e1206580638b29c75fceb44051618e94e0313c3ca2bb26347791fdefc7f7a8fa:2

value
24564661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d145ae10f66fc7cb9be40e5f8719706147d1c4e OP_EQUALVERIFY OP_CHECKSIG
address
1JEm6YfSg2fG7KhZnDHr2sMvowFVey7bLx
transaction
e1206580638b29c75fceb44051618e94e0313c3ca2bb26347791fdefc7f7a8fa
spent
true